Exemplifying the Ideals of the NHS

New members were inducted today into the National Honor Society Mercedes Higuera Chapter, joining a distinguished group defined by Knowledge, Scholarship, Service, Character, and Leadership.
These students embody the values that shape ethical leaders and lifelong learners, driven by purpose, guided by integrity, and committed to serving others.

Members and inductees from the Class of 2025 also received their official NHS tassels, a symbol of excellence they will proudly wear at their Commencement Exercises with their cap and gown.

Saint John’s School is a non-profit, college preparatory, nonsectarian, coeducational day school founded in 1915. The school, located in a residential area of Condado, in San Juan, Puerto Rico, has an enrollment of over 800 students from Toddler to grade twelve. Instruction is mostly in English with the exception of language courses.
